Thermal lensing in a diode-end-pumped continuous-wave self-Raman Nd-doped GdVO4 laser

We have directly measured thermal lensing in a continuous-wave Nd-doped GdVO4 self-Raman laser under diode pumping at 808 and 879 nm. Thermal lensing increased significantly when generating first-Stokes emission, this most likely originating from impurity absorption and/or excited-state absorption at high pump powers. Pumping at 879 nm significantly reduced thermal lens effects in the laser crystal compared with pumping at 808 nm.
